First launch (one-time Gatekeeper step)

This build is ad-hoc signed but not notarized by Apple, so macOS blocks it the first time. Do one of:

  • macOS 14 (Sonoma) and earlier — right-click the app in Applications → OpenOpen.
  • macOS 15 (Sequoia) — double-click once (it gets blocked), then open System Settings → Privacy & Security and click Open Anyway.
  • Terminal (any version)xattr -dr com.apple.quarantine /Applications/FocalPlanner.app

After this one-time step the app opens normally. On first run, grant Calendar and Reminders access when prompted.
